The Weight Difference: Lead Acid vs. Lithium Ion Batteries for Motorcycles

In the realm of motorcycles, every component plays a crucial role in performance, handling, and overall riding experience. One of the often-overlooked components is the battery. Traditionally, lead acid batteries have dominated the market, but as technology advances, lithium ion batteries are emerging as a formidable alternative. In this article, we will delve into the weight difference between these two battery types and discuss their implications on motorcycle performance and user experience.

Understanding the Battery Types

Before we dive into the specifics of weight, it’s important to understand what distinguishes lead acid and lithium ion batteries. Lead acid batteries, named for their lead plates and sulfuric acid electrolyte, have been the standard for many decades. They are reliable, affordable, and fairly straightforward in terms of maintenance.

Lithium ion batteries, on the other hand, utilize lithium compounds for their electrolyte and offer a modern alternative that is quickly gaining traction due to its lighter weight and higher energy density. This shift towards lithium ion technology is driven both by advancements in technology and an increasing demand from consumers for high-performance products.

Weight Comparison

Weight is a significant factor when it comes to motorcycle batteries. A typical lead acid motorcycle battery can weigh anywhere from 12 to 25 pounds (5.4 to 11.3 kg), depending on its size and capacity. In contrast, lithium ion batteries weigh approximately 5 to 12 pounds (2.3 to 5.4 kg) for comparable applications. This remarkable weight difference translates directly into performance advantages and handling improvements.

Performance Impact of Weight

Reducing the weight of your motorcycle can have a pronounced effect on your riding experience. A lighter battery allows for better performance in several areas:

  • Acceleration: With a lighter battery, the overall weight of the bike is reduced, leading to quicker acceleration times. For motorcycle enthusiasts, this can be a game-changer.
  • Handling: Less weight contributes to improved handling and maneuverability, especially in curves and tight spots. Riders will find that their motorcycle remains more stable with a lithium ion battery.
  • Braking Distance: A lighter bike can result in shorter braking distances due to reduced inertia. This is particularly important for riders who enjoy spirited riding or track days.

Longevity and Maintenance

While weight is a sterling quality of lithium ion batteries, longevity is another area where they significantly outperform lead acid batteries. Lead acid batteries typically last 3 to 5 years with proper maintenance, while lithium ion batteries can exceed 10 years. Additionally, lithium ion batteries require little to no maintenance, as they do not suffer from issues such as sulfation, which is common in lead acid units.

Charging Efficiency

Charging speed is another aspect that highlights the advantages of lithium ion batteries. They charge much faster than lead acid batteries, which is an important factor for motorcyclists who are eager to get back on the road. Lithium ion batteries can often reach a full charge in just a couple of hours, whereas lead acid batteries might take significantly longer, especially when considering the need for specific charging protocols.

Environmental Impact

Moreover, the environmental impact of these two types of batteries can't be ignored. Lead acid batteries have a challenging disposal process due to the toxic materials; they are hazardous if not recycled correctly. Conversely, lithium ion batteries, while also requiring responsible disposal, generally have a lesser environmental impact over their lifecycle and can often be recycled more efficiently.

Cost Considerations

The initial cost of lithium ion batteries is significantly higher than that of lead acid batteries, which can deter some riders from making the switch. Lead acid batteries can be found for under $100, while lithium ion counterparts typically start at around $200 and can go up to $600 or more. However, when considering the longevity and performance improvements, many riders find that lithium ion batteries provide better overall value.
